Purpose of the establishment of this club is to want the people of Sisaket and youth to become interested in sports and to push the youth in the province to develop their football skills at the national level.
[2] The club has finished 2nd place in the league of the Northeastern region and advanced to the national championship stage.
In addition, in the 2022–23 Thai FA Cup Sisaket United was penalty shoot-out defeated 5–6 by Police Tero in the fourth round, causing them to be eliminated[3] and in the 2022–23 Thai League Cup Sisaket United was defeated 0–2 by Muangthong United in the first round, causing them to be eliminated too.
